The Franciscan Restaurant
Additional Details:
On Fisherman's Wharf, designed in a three-tiered arrangement, providing all patrons with an unobstructed view of a most beautiful expanse of the Bay, Alcatraz Island and the City. In this unusual atmosphere discerning diners partake of the finest food and drink available anywhere. |